Far Frontiers Gateway sector

189-2508 Gateway News Service- Dustball

Finally Far Star Mining and Exploration has been caught red handed in illegal claim jumping, and land piracy as one of its crawlers attempted to destroy the crawler operated by the Dustball Hard Luck Speculative Mining Company. On board were Peter and Stacy Matoshi along with their picked crew of hard cases. The Far Star mining crawler attacked with a mining laser, causing severe damage to the Matoshi crawler, and crippling its communication gear.

In a fire fight that lasted almost half an hour, the Matoshi crew and their hired mercenaries managed to board the Far Star crawler, and take it over. The communication gear on the Far Star crawler was used to call the Dustball Constabulary, who arrived before a backup mining crawler from Far Star arrived on the scene. The arriving Far Star crawler opened fire on the Constabulary, killing six and wounding five constables.

As the Constables sent out an SOS for help, a marine Platoon from the New Texas Dustball force was able to drop from orbit, and come to the aid of the force on the ground. A small kinetic strike on the Far Star crawler destroyed it utterly, and the Marines were able to provide first aid and medical treatment for all the wounded.

As the battledress equipped marines were involved in a fire fight with the Far Star crew, medics called for dustoff to come in and take the wounded to the Dry Gulch hospital. At the end of the firefight there are 2 unwounded Far Star employees, 11 wounded, and 23 dead. The damaged crawler was scoured for clues by responding Constabulary back up units, and they found conclusive evidence that Far Star Mining and Exploration has been involved in several attempts on the Dustball Hard Luck Speculative Mining Company, as well as the attack on Hammerhead Matoshi which put him in the hospital.

Sergei Gregorovich Romanov, the head of Far Star Mining has denied any knowledge, claiming that the crew that attacked the Matoshi mining crawler was a renegade group which had stolen both crawlers from his vehicle park. However the evidence found proves that Mr. Romanov had full knowledge and indeed had ordered the attack in an attempt to drive off Matoshi and bankrupt his company.

Based on this information, the Grand Poobah has ordered the seizure of all assets of Far Star Mining and Exploration pending a hearing in court. Mr. Romanov, his daughter, son, and assistants have been ordered held in the L'Narkia prison until such time as the hearing. Romanov has filed an emergency motion to hold based on the supposition that as a human he cannot get a fair hearing, and is demanding that a human rather than K'Grech court hear his case. He has filed this with the New Texas ambassador, who quickly denied his request for New Texas intervention.

Romanov is claiming that since the K'Grech took back control of their world from the human operated Chartered Dustball Company, that humans are being treated unfairly, and is asking for outside aid to help the human settlers resist the "Alien overlords who are oppressing the humans". He is joined in this by a band of disgruntled former plantation, and mining concern owners who have seen their unacceptable behavior restricted since the K'Grech have reclaimed their planet.
 
191-2508 Gateway News Service- Xanadu

Pollen season has started early this year, and it looks to be bad, very bad. The winter was mild with extra rain across much of the area where the Xanadu Devil Weed is located. The pollen counts have shown much higher than normal with an extra amount of adhesive, which is as usual wreaking havoc with much of the normal life operations on this planet. Sales of face shields, filter masks, and over suits are higher than normal as the nasty yellow pollen gets everywhere. Due to the axial tilt of Xanadu, winds at this time of year are somewhat higher than normal.

Pets are especially at risk since they do not understand the need for masks, so a line of dog and cat masks and over suits have been produced to protect Man's Best Friend during these times of the year. Adding to the mess the Umbrella trees have started detaching as well, which can cause accidents when one of the floating tops comes in contact with an aircraft. Children under 15 kilos in weight can be injured if a blowing Pop Top strikes them, it can knock them down causing injury.

As is common the Traveler's Aid Society has issued a warning to ensure that all travelers to Xanadu are aware of the pollen season. Dr. Chu Myong-son of the Xanadu Meteorological Observatory system is telling GNS that he expects the pollen to peak in two weeks, and then slowly decline over the following five weeks.

Sales of Klean Up wipes has been heavy, along with sales of pollen removal solution for the showers inside of each building. Proposals have been made to eradicate the Devil Weed, but ecologists caution against this since several species of animals depend on the pollen and Devil Weed for food. The Maroon Seed Eater is one of the animals which love on the pollen as one of its primary food items at this time of the year. The Maroon Seed Eater is also a vital link in the ecological chain on Xanadu, and are a protected species.
